Output 90a250aa93dbd0c9380535710562ead4e489fdd4c90376c7d270eda2ae46c8be:3

value
139634164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f17af56cc7612c64485539dc16a420f0689b9ea OP_EQUAL
address
MDemBAxSn2Ea28DXQY4tFLo3jAhJAwyY4u
transaction
90a250aa93dbd0c9380535710562ead4e489fdd4c90376c7d270eda2ae46c8be
spent
true